Program Objective

Microsoft SharePoint Specialist Program supports IT professionals who currently have core or foundation knowledge and want to earn a MCTS certification on SharePoint. The purpose of the training is to increase: (1) enrollments in training that results in an employer-recognized IT certification; (2) training retentions and completions; and (3) the number of individuals qualified for, getting, and retaining employment in demanding occupations directly related to the training program.

Class Days

Class days can range from 2 days to 10 days to prepare for the exam. The assessment will dictate the number of classes that will be required.

Training/Instructional Aids and Facilities

Each classroom includes Internet connection and a variety of equipment such as whiteboards, projectors, easels, and other kinds of teaching materials to enhance the training experience. All training will be conducted on equipment that exceeds the requirements established by the course author and includes one computer per participant and one instructor computer with the following minimum specification:

  • Dual Processor 2.0 GHz or faster
  • 8 GB of memory
  • 2 disk drives of 250 GB each or greater
  • 17” Monitor, Keyboard, Mouse
  • Internet connection
